In specialized fields like microscopy, an image logger is a critical accessory for Atomic Force Microscopes (AFM).

Functionality: These loggers, such as those from AFMWorkshop, allow users to simultaneously view multiple image channels (up to six) in both forward and reverse directions.

Data Visualization: It provides real-time oscilloscope-style data logging and visualizes the spectrum of data channels during a scan.

In the world of data science, Lux-Logger is a GitHub project developed as a Jupyter notebook extension. Its core purpose is to facilitate research by logging frontend UI events. lux image logger

How it Works: It tracks how users interact with the Lux visualization library, which is designed to automate the discovery of visual patterns in Pandas dataframes.

Data Captured: The logger records actions such as cell execution, kernel restarts, and specific UI interactions within the Lux widget.

Primary Use Case: It is used by researchers (often at institutions like UC Berkeley) to understand how data scientists explore data, helping them improve the intelligent recommendation systems within the Lux API. 2. Industrial Lux Data Loggers (Hardware)

High-Dynamic Range (HDR) Sensing: Utilizing sensors like the TLS2550, these loggers approximate the human eye's response to light. They provide accurate lux readings across a wide range of intensities, from dim indoor lighting to direct sunlight.

Time-Series Data Recording: Measurements are often taken at set intervals (e.g., every 6 hours) and stored in internal EEPROM memory. This allows for long-term monitoring—up to several years depending on memory capacity.

Environmentally Isolated Housing: To ensure data integrity, sensors are often housed in sealed project boxes that isolate the light source being measured from ambient interference. Technical Connectivity & Output

I2C Interface: Most modern lux sensors use an I2C digital interface, allowing them to communicate easily with microcontrollers like Arduino-compatible boards.

The rise of LED volumes (used in shows like The Mandalorian) demands extreme precision. The walls are screens, and real actors move in front of them. If the physical lighting on the actor doesn't match the Lux output of the LED wall, the effect breaks. Lux Image Loggers are used to map the intensity of the physical lights against the screen, ensuring that a character walking from a shadow into sunlight transitions seamlessly between real and virtual illumination.

    What is a Lux Image Logger? A Lux Image Logger is a software application or integrated hardware-software system that automatically records illuminance values (measured in Lux) and embeds or associates this data with captured image files. Unlike standard metadata (EXIF) which records camera settings like aperture, shutter speed, and ISO, a Lux Logger focuses on the environment itself. It answers the question not of how the camera was set, but what the light conditions actually were at the precise moment of capture.
